Hon Thom - a getaway close to nature

Hon Thom (Pineapple Islet) is one of the many harbours of Phu Quoc Island, which lies in the Gulf of Thailand, 45km from Ha Tien and 15km south of the coast of Cambodia.

However, compared to other harbours where international and domestic ships anchor, the small port city is arguably the most lively and crowded with some unique characters.

With an area of 400ha, Hon Thom has sloping seashore, white sand, coral reefs and about 110 fishermen. The primitive view of huge rocks, hills could easily worry tourists on their way to the islet.

However, as the boat draws nearer, the view takes a completely different turn. There is a crowded fishing village with different kinds of fishing boats. The area is said to be a good fishing place with a large number of shrimps and fishes. One can also see how a good fisherman dive and catch small groupers with bare hands. Next to the fishing boats are small rafts supplying marine products ranging from crabs to cuttlefishes to visitors.

Upon entering the shore, visitors can enjoy a small but crowded market which sells ready-made clothes, canned food and footwear. There are tens of food stalls too. The two round-trip boat routes to the islet ensure the market always has fresh food. The eateries serve mainly to fishermen from neighbouring areas such as Ca Mau, Phu Quoc Island and Rach Gia who have anchored for trading and rest.

Visitors can go along a 1km sand road where coconut trees link the two poles of the islet that looks like it has cut the islet in two equal parts. The road is the islet’s equivalent of downtown - there are motorbike taxi services, karaoke section, ice-making factory, post office and drinking stalls. Most of the islet’s residents live along the road.

Ships cannot land at Hon Thom, so motored boats transport tourists to the islet. It costs VND 10,000 for four people.
